Organize Your Financial Documents

The first step in preparing for tax season is to gather all necessary documents. This includes W-2s, 1099s, receipts, and any other relevant financial records. Keeping these documents organized can save you time and stress when it comes time to file.

Consider using a digital tool or app to keep track of your documents. This can help you easily access the information you need and ensure nothing is lost. Start organizing early to avoid the last-minute rush.

Maximize Deductions and Credits

One of the best ways to reduce your tax liability is by maximizing deductions and credits. Midlothian residents should explore opportunities such as home office deductions, education credits, and energy-efficient home improvements.

Ensure that you have all the necessary documentation to support your claims. This can prevent complications or delays in processing your return.

Common Deductions

  • Mortgage interest
  • Charitable donations
  • Medical expenses

Plan for Estimated Taxes

If you are self-employed or have other income not subject to withholding, planning for estimated taxes is crucial. Paying these taxes quarterly can help you avoid penalties and interest.

Use last year’s tax return as a guide to estimate your taxes for the current year. Adjust your payments if you expect a significant change in income or expenses.

Utilize Tax Software

Tax software can simplify the filing process and help ensure accuracy. Many programs offer step-by-step guidance and can identify potential deductions and credits you may have overlooked.

Compare different software options to find the one that fits your needs and budget. Some software also offers free filing for basic returns.
